Math Riddles
Two fathers and two sons sat down to eat eggs for breakfast. They ate exactly three eggs. Each person had an egg. How is this possible?
How can you add eight 8′s to get the number 1,000?
When asked how old she was, Suzie replied, “In two years I will be twice as old as I was five years ago.”
How old is Suzie?
You are on a ship, over the side hangs a rope ladder with half meter rungs. The tide rises a half meter per hour. At the end of five hours, how much of the ladder will remain above the water assuming that nine rungs were above the water when the tide began to rise?
A tree doubled in height each year until it reaches its maximum height over the course of ten years.
How many years did it take for the tree to reach half its maximum height?
If you go to the movies and you are paying, is it cheaper to take one friend to the movies twice or two friends to the movies at the same time?
If someone says to you, “I’ll bet you $1 that if you give $2, I will give you $3 in return”, would this be a good be for you to accept?
